Windows filesystems support Unicode filenames, and Python provides the necessary tools to work with them. When using subprocess.Popen() to execute external commands that involve Unicode filenames, it's essential to handle encoding and decoding properly.
Let's consider an example where we want to list the files in a directory using the dir command, and the directory contains files with Unicode filenames.
The shell=True parameter in subprocess.Popen() is used to run the command in a shell, which is necessary for some commands like dir.
The stdout=subprocess.PIPE and stderr=subprocess.PIPE parameters capture the standard output and standard error of the subprocess, allowing you to handle them as needed.
